Fifteen England fans were arrested at the Euro 2024 semi-final against the Netherlands on Wednesday, UK police have confirmed.
About 25,000 England supporters were at the match in Dortmund, with the vast majority described as “well behaved”.
Before the game, five people suffered minor injuries when England fans were attacked by Netherlands supporters in the town centre.
In a statement, UK police – who were in Germany to work alongside local police – said the trouble was dealt with effectively by German law enforcement with the support of their officers.
UK police added there were no serious incidents reported after the match.
England beat the Netherlands 2-1 and will face Spain in the final on Sunday in Berlin (kick-off 20:00 BST).
